DESCRIPTION:All we say to America is be true to what you said on paper.\n — Martin Luther King\, Jr.\, “I’ve Been to the Mountaintop…” \nIf you say\, I quit or I sentence you or I refuse\, you have acted. These are speech acts: speech that\, as it is uttered\, acts on and in the world. Powerful speech\, but also everyday speech. Political speech\, but also speech in your home\, your classroom\, your dorm room.  I assert. I promise. I do.  \nIt’s more complicated than that. Speech acts in complicated ways—so does writing. And they act on each other. DESCRIPTION:Come learn how to build sculptures and figurines—entirely out of paper! 3D origami is a type of modular origami in which hundreds of paper pieces are stacked together.
